When it comes to comparing pet insurance plans, there are a plethora of factors to consider. While it can be tempting to opt for the plan offering the lowest premiums, it's essential to look beyond the initial cost and dive deeper into what each plan offers.

Coverage

Firstly, it's critical to understand the types of coverage different pet insurance plans provide. Generally, pet insurance coverage falls into three main categories:

  • Accident-only coverage: This type of insurance covers vet costs if your pet gets injured in an accident. However, it doesn't cover illnesses or preventative care.
  • Wellness coverage: This covers routine care, such as vaccinations, heartworm tests, and wellness exams, but it doesn't cover accidents or illnesses.
  • Comprehensive coverage: This type of insurance covers both accidents and illnesses, as well as routine care. It's the most extensive option, but it's also generally the most expensive.

Exclusions

It's also vital to look into any exclusions a pet insurance plan might have. These are the conditions or circumstances that the plan doesn't cover. For example, many plans don't cover pre-existing conditions, hereditary and congenital conditions, or cosmetic procedures.

Cost

Another crucial aspect to consider is the cost of the plan. This includes not only the monthly premium but also the deductible you have to pay before the insurance starts covering costs, and the co-pay, which is the percentage of the vet bill you're responsible for after the deductible is met.

💡
Remember, cheaper isn't always better. It's important to consider what you're getting for your money and whether it will actually meet your pet's needs.

Reputation

Last but not least, consider the insurance company's reputation. Look at customer reviews and ratings, the company's track record in paying out claims, and the quality of their customer service.

Comparison of Pet Insurance Providers

Deciding on the right pet insurance provider can feel overwhelming with the multitude of options available. Comparing the cost and coverage of various pet insurance companies can give you a clearer idea of which one suits your needs and budget best. Here, you'll find a comparison of some of the best pet insurance providers.

1. Healthy Paws

Known for its all-inclusive coverage and great customer service, Healthy Paws is a top contender in the pet insurance world. They offer one simple plan that covers all unexpected accidents and illnesses.

2. Trupanion

With its straightforward, one-plan coverage, Trupanion is another great choice for pet insurance. They offer 90% coverage on all unexpected illnesses and injuries, which includes all diagnostic tests, surgeries, hospital stays, and medications.

3. Nationwide

Nationwide is well-known for being the only pet insurance company to offer avian and exotic pet coverage. They provide a variety of plans that cover everything from accidents and illnesses to wellness and preventive care.

4. Embrace

Embrace is a top-rated pet insurance provider that offers comprehensive coverage for accidents, illnesses, genetic conditions, and more. They also have a customizable wellness plan to help cover routine care costs.

💡
Note: With any pet insurance provider, it's crucial to read the fine print and understand exactly what's covered and what's not. Ensure you're aware of any deductibles, copayments, and maximum payouts.

Tips for Saving Money on Pet Insurance

Securing your pet's health without straining your finances is the goal of every pet parent. Here are some pivotal strategies that can help you cut costs on your pet insurance plan while ensuring that your furry friend gets the care they need.

Choose a Higher Deductible: A deductible is the amount you pay out-of-pocket before your insurance kicks in. Opting for a higher deductible can lower your premium substantially. But, remember to keep the deductible within an affordable range in case of an emergency.

  • Take Advantage of Discounts: Many pet insurance companies offer discounts for multiple pets, paying annually instead of monthly, or even for being a member of certain organizations. So, explore these options to save more.
  • Compare Plans: Just like any other insurance, prices for pet insurance can vary widely. Use online tools to compare premiums, coverage, and customer reviews from multiple providers.

Preventive Care: Keeping your pet healthy could help you avoid making claims, thereby saving you money. Regular check-ups, proper diet, exercise, and preventive medications can help avert serious health issues down the line.
